- One thing is clear from our Cash Grab investigation: do not fly with cash. Regardless of the amount.
Although it's perfectly legal to fly domestically with even $1M in your bag, the government is seizing cash and accusing people of being connected to criminal activity. The thing is--under civil asset forfeiture the government doesn't have to prove it.

This is outright theft. For years, for decades, Louisiana did this on I10. They would stop drivers, search for "drugs", take the money and walk away.
That money was kept by the sheriff's department and they had massive buildings, huge gyms, totally self contained buildings and the finest vehicles...
I can't remember which major news station did an undercover piece un which they had cameras on the speedometer, had the car checked out by mechanics, lawyers and outside law enforcement to make sure that there was absolutely no reason to pull the vehicle over.
Each car was followed by a backup vehicle filming to further prove that there was no reason for the stops and no longer being broken.
Finally they were able to prove that this was standard operating procedure for those departments on I10.
Only because it was on National news was this ever admitted to by those departments but the practice wasn't outlawed.
